Bright-blue organic-light-emitting-diodes based on carbazolic-compounds as emitting layers or dopant in DPVBi matrix are described. Pure-blue light with CIE coordinates xy = (0.158;0.169) and external quantum efficiency as high as etaext = 3.3% were obtained.
We present a multilayer organic-light-emitting-diode design which allows total control of the emitted color (including white emission) through the accurate modification of a yellow ultrathin emitter position and thickness in a blue matrix.
